Skip to content

Global Net Lease GNL Ratios & Valuation

FY'25FY'24FY'23FY'22
Profitability
Operating margin22.4%-10.6pp33%26.5%-2.1pp
EBITDA margin61%-10.1pp71.1%+35.5pp35.6%-31.6pp67.2%-3.1pp
Free cash flow margin38.2%-6.3pp44.5%40.1%-7.1pp
Returns
Return on invested capital6.2%-1.9pp8.1%+9.2pp-1.1%-8.0pp6.9%+3.2pp
Efficiency
Asset turnover0.1×0.0×0.1×0.0×0.1×0.0×0.1×0.0×
Leverage
Debt-to-equity0.0×0.0×0.0×0.0×
Debt-to-assets0.0×0.0×0.0×0.0×
Net debt / EBITDA-0.5×-0.2×-0.3×+0.2×-0.5×-0.1×-0.3×-0.1×
Interest coverage0.6×-0.2×0.7×+0.9×-0.1×-1.2×-0.2×
Per Share
Book value per share$7.45-21.5%$9.49-48.7%$18.50+33.3%$13.88-15.8%
Valuation
Market capitalization$1.89B+12.0%$1.68B-26.5%$2.29B+75.7%$1.3B-17.6%
Enterprise value$1.75B+11.7%$1.56B-29.5%$2.22B+81.4%$1.22B-19.3%
Price / sales3.8×+0.9×-2.2×5.1×+1.7×3.4×-0.6×
Price / book1.1×+0.4×0.8×-0.1×0.9×0.0×0.9×-0.1×
EV / EBITDA5.8×+1.9×3.9×-10.1×14×+9.2×4.8×-0.7×
EV / sales3.5×+0.8×2.7×-2.2×+1.7×3.2×-0.6×
Free cash flow yield10%-5.0pp15.1%11.6%0.0pp
Dividend yield10.2%-6.0pp16.2%+7.1pp9%-3.8pp12.8%+2.9pp

Chart any of these lines over time, or line them up against competitors.

Compare these in charts →

Questions, answered.

What are Global Net Lease's profit margins?
Global Net Lease (GNL) runs a 89.4% gross margin and a 36.0% operating margin, with a -54.3% net margin.
Where do Global Net Lease's ratios come from?
Every ratio is computed from Global Net Lease's SEC filings — trailing-twelve-month flows over period-end balances. Valuation multiples combine those fundamentals with market data, recomputed each period. Switch between quarterly, annual, and TTM, or open any ratio for its full history and peer comparisons.